Koyukuk, AK is a small town in north-central Alaska and has a housing median value of around $158,000. This is significantly lower than the US house median value, which stands at $338,100. Despite this disparity in prices, Koyukuk has maintained slight positive growth in its housing market over the past year with an appreciation rate of 1.58%, though this is still far less than the 8.27% appreciation rate seen across the US as a whole. The median home cost in Koyukuk is $158,000. Home appreciation the last 10 years has been 43.5%. Home Appreciation in Koyukuk is up 8.2%.

Average Age of Homes
- The median age of Koyukuk real estate is 33 years old
The Rental Market in Koyukuk
- Renters make up 33.3% of the Koyukuk population
- 0.0% of houses and apartments in Koyukuk, are available to rent
